About the role

Responsibilities

  • Act as the primary point of contact for general inquiries regarding space and catering arrangements
  • Confirm room bookings and coordinate the schedule for program and event calendars
  • Generate sales leads by calling targeted potential clients and promoting event services
  • Pitch for new business using innovative sales techniques and foster a network of external contacts
  • Analyze client needs to provide recommendations on event logistics and options
  • Promote venues and event services to potential clients and conduct physical tours of bookable spaces
  • Maintain sales metrics, prepare reports, and manage client interactions via CRM

Requirements

  • Bachelor's Degree or an acceptable combination of equivalent education and experience
  • Minimum of three years of experience in calendar management, sales coordination, and customer service
  • Proven experience in a client-facing role serving as a primary point of contact
  • Hands-on experience using CRM systems (e.g., Salesforce)
  • Experience working with booking or scheduling software (e.g., EMS or similar platforms)
  • Strong communication, interpersonal, and organizational skills
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ience in a hospitality-focused customer service environment
  • Proficiency with EMS software
  • Existing knowledge of the University of Toronto community
  • An established roster of professional clients

About the Company

Hart House is a centre for experiential education at the University of Toronto, providing co-curricular programming in the arts, dialogue, and wellness. Operating through a social enterprise model, Hart House generates revenue to support student-focused programming across all three University of Toronto campuses. Our Hospitality Services team is dedicated to delivering exceptional experiences through thoughtful planning and superlative customer service.
